Second Gayest City in America
As a result of the US Census, the City of Wilton Manors was named the “Second Gayest City” in the United States. With a large percentage of the population identifying as gay, lesbian, bisexual, or transgender, Wilton Manors has been a progressive place to live, labor and play for many years. In , and again in subsequent years, Wilton Manors was named by South Florida Gay News (SFGN) as the Leading City in its “Best Of" competition. You can read the story here. How it All Began
Greater Fort Lauderdale has been at the forefront, blazing a trail with progressive laws that protect and empower the LGBT+ community. Notably, the cities of Fort Lauderdale, Hollywood, Oakland Park, and Wilton Manors have received perfect scores on the municipality equality index by the Human Rights Campaign.
